How PullScope keeps its public content grounded

PullScope publishes product guides, workflow explainers, comparison pages, and collector-facing support content. The goal is clarity, not hype.

What we publish

We focus on content that explains scan flow, confidence, back-photo logic, price direction, saved history, and the limits of automated card identification.

How content is reviewed

  • The PullScope Editorial Desk drafts and updates the content.
  • The PullScope Research Review Desk checks that claims stay cautious and consistent with the product.
  • Pages are updated when product behavior, pricing, support rules, or policy language materially changes.

Evidence rules

  • We do not present scan output as a grading or authenticity guarantee.
  • We describe value as guidance, not as a promised sale outcome.
  • We keep card-specific claims tied to visible evidence such as set code, number, finish, layout, and confidence level.

When we escalate beyond app guidance

If a topic materially affects grading, authentication, insurance, legal disputes, or high-value resale decisions, we direct the reader toward slower specialist review instead of pretending the app is the final word.
